The first test is with openchrome SVN 817, external monitor connected.
Results: on both displays the right and bottom part of the desktop is not 
visible, out of the size of the 1024x768 screen size. Mouse is visible on both 
displays.

It is interesting that the panel size is recognised correctly as shown in the 
log file but not that resolution is used:
    (II) CHROME(0): Native Panel Resolution is 1024x768

The following xorg.conf is used:

Section "Device"
        Identifier      "Configured Video Device"
        Driver          "openchrome"
        Option          "ModeSwitchMethod" "new"
EndSection

Section "Monitor"
        Identifier      "Configured Monitor"
EndSection

Section "Screen"
        Identifier      "Default Screen"
        Monitor         "Configured Monitor"
        Device          "Configured Video Device"
EndSection
